Grandma's Yorkshire Pudding
A delicious compliment to our roast beef recipe! Makes 6-8 Yorkshire puddings






Directions
-
Preheat oven to 450°F. Using a large muffin tin, spoon out as much of
the beef drippings from roast as you can into the muffin tins (8 muffin
cups total). -
Place an additional 1-2 tsp vegetable oil, per muffin cup. There should
be about 1/2 inch of oil ⁄ drippings in the bottom of each cup. -
Place oil filled muffin tray into oven & allow to heat for 10 mins or until
the oil is smoking hot. -
While the pan is heating, mix all remaining ingredients.
-
Once pan is heated, place 2-3 tbsp of batter in each cup. Be careful, it will be extremely hot. You will also have to do this step rather fast.
-
Bake Yorkshires for 12-15 mins until they rise well above the edge of the cups & are a golden brown colour.
-
Carefully remove from oven. IMPORTANT: Make sure that the roast rests for a minimum of 20 mins before carving.
Ingredients
- 2 Eggs
- 1 cup Milk
- 3 tbsp Beef drippings
- 3-4 tbsp Vegetable oil
- 1 cup All purpose flour, sifted
- 1 tsp Salt
